The 2022 Fairfield County Puerto Rican Parade will be held on Sunday, July 10 and Girl Scouts of Connecticut will be there!
The parade is a celebration of Puerto Rican culture and heritage with an array of participating groups marching, playing music and dancing from Central High School to Seaside Park in Bridgeport. Girl Scouts Troops and Families are invited to march in the parade wearing their uniforms or sashes, displaying a poster with their troop number and city/town, and joining in song and cheer!

Marchers: Join other Girl Scouts at the beginning of the parade at Central High School (1 Lincoln Blvd, Bridgeport). You have the option of parking either at the beginning or at the end of the parade route near Seaside Park and taking a ride back to the beginning of the route at the high school.
Parade length: 2.5 miles
Weather: Parade is held rain or shine, please dress accordingly.
